Crop-duster pilot killed in Pinehurst crash


PINEHURST — Dooly County authorities say a pilot has died in a crop-duster crash.

The plane crashed about 11:45 a.m. Thursday while attempting to land in Pinehurst. Kathleen Bergen, a spokeswoman for the Federal Aviation Administration, says the Cessna 188-B aircraft was owned by A&C; Ag Aviation.

The pilot's name was not immediately released. A&C; Ag Aviation president David Chancy declined to comment before informing the pilot's family of his death.

Bergen says the cause of the crash remains under investigation.
